Smart Flip Keys

This smart flip key is an excellent way to keep track of your car keys, particularly when they're lost. It connects with your phone to help locate your keys. A chime will be sent that sounds even when your phone's on silent. You can also utilize your phone to locate the key using an interactive map that is available in the app.

This smart flip key features 4 buttons: Lock, Unlock and Panic, and Trunk Release. The shell is made from high-quality materials and is durable. The buttons feel solid, and they're easy to press. The key blade and battery are included. It is necessary to transfer the inner workings of your old keys to the new one. This may be a bit difficult, but it's doable.

You should first check that your Audi is equipped with a transponder. This type of chip is used to store your vehicle's unique password, making it more difficult for criminals to duplicate and compromise the security of your vehicle. The chips are designed to last for a long time, but if they do fail, they can be replaced by an experienced locksmith.

Traditional keys are basic metal fobs which require manual insertion to start your car. While these are becoming less popular on newer Audi models, some drivers may use them as backups or for older vehicles. In these instances locksmiths can copy the key's shell at less than dealers charge. Locksmiths can also salvage the chip that was damaged and reuse it into the creation of a new key, which will save you even more money.

Smart key systems are available in many modern cars. They permit you to unlock the car with the touch of a button and also start the car with no physical key. This is a fantastic convenience however, there are some downsides. Consider the pros and cons of a push-to start audi key fob key prior to making a choice.

One of the greatest advantages of having a smart key is that you'll never be locked out of your car again. Even if you forget to lock your keys in the car or put them down when you shop, the majority of smart keys come with a small LED light that will alert you when they're running low on battery power. This feature can prevent the unintentional locking of your vehicle, which is common among New York City drivers with busy schedules.

Smart keys can also be safer for drivers since they prevent you from locking yourself out of your car. If you're in a risky area or a neighborhood with high crime rates it could be risky to stand around in front of your vehicle, fumbling for your keys while being watched by criminals.

A push-to-start button will also simplify your life by making it possible to start your car while your key is still in your purse or pocket. This can be especially helpful for those who live in a cold climate and want to get your car warm before you head out for a cold, chilly morning.

Another benefit of smart keys is that they are more durable than traditional key fobs. Because they have the most sophisticated electronic circuitry, they are more resistant to damage than ordinary key fobs. But, if you drop your Audi key or knock it into a hard surface, the circuitry can be easily damaged. If you want your keypads with smart features to last longer, stay clear of these hazards.
